which statement best describes a mole?\no it is 12 units of a given substance.\no it contains 6.02×10²³ grams of sodium chloride.\no it is the mass of 12 carbon atoms.\no it contains 6.02×10²³ particles of a given substance.

Answer

Brief Explanations:

A mole is defined as the amount of a substance that contains Avogadro's number ($6.02\times 10^{23}$) of particles (atoms, molecules, ions etc.). It is not 12 units of a substance, nor is it the mass of 12 carbon - atoms in the way described, and it doesn't mean $6.02\times 10^{23}$ grams of a substance.

Answer:

It contains $6.02\times 10^{23}$ particles of a given substance.
